Transaction 86c267543d20325584c44a133b86af4eeab5d1d792e9a04927889abcbb6fda96
1 Input
1 Output
-
86c267543d20325584c44a133b86af4eeab5d1d792e9a04927889abcbb6fda96:0
- value
- 24550
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0b36b57719a315dfd9f87a12aef4d30de71921f
- address
- ltc1q6zekk4m3ngc4mlvls7sj4m6dxr08rysldzymka